Chapman Tapped to Lead VPS in the Americas

VPS has appointed Neil Chapman as its new Managing Director of the Americas, bringing a wealth of experience in Testing and Inspection to the role. With over 40 years of industry expertise, Chapman is well-positioned to help customers navigate the evolving marine fuels mix and Carbon taxation landscape.

His extensive background includes senior commercial leadership roles, where he has developed a deep understanding of how to deliver tangible value to clients and operate as a true partner in the ever-changing marine industry. This appointment comes at a time when fuel quality, emissions regulations, and carbon accountability are increasingly important considerations for companies operating in the region.

VPS is uniquely positioned to help customers make smarter, more sustainable operational decisions. With Chapman at the helm, the company is well-equipped to tackle the challenges of this complex landscape and drive up profitability for its clients.

The appointment was made by Dr. Malcolm Cooper, CEO of VPS, who stated that Chapman's sector knowledge will be invaluable in helping customers improve their operational efficiency.
